ErnieCindyTAR19:
Hello Indonesia!

We had an awesome cab driver in Indonesia! For Leg 2 when we were in Yogyakarta, Heru met us at the train station, then came back to pick us up at 7am in the morning to take us to the cave, Goa Jablong. We only got lost a little when we were following Marcus & Amani's taxi and Bill & Cathi beat us to the cave, but otherwise, he was right on track with everywhere we needed to go. He was a total rock star and while we were off doing a task, he would look up where the next location was and call all of his friends to find out where to go.

Our driver on Leg 3 at Borobudur our taxi driver was also good - a little more quiet and didn't "fist pump" with us, but he got us everywhere we needed to go and was very kind to wait for us while Ernie counted the Buddhas.  We were definitely lucky!
